    O ring question

    For Pioneer style, as best I’ve been able to tell and in my experience: 1/2” coupler: number 117 buna-n 70a (medium) hardness 3/8” coupler: number 115 buna-n 70a 1/4” coupler: number 113 buna-n 70a No clue about flat face. I haven’t seen those sizes in the assortment box type kits at HF...

    Loaded tire fluid level

    Yes, but it’s also normal to get a little squirt of fluid when you first pop open the Schrader valve even if the valve is above the fluid level. If you get a continuous stream with the valve at 12 o’clock, that would be abnormal for properly filled tires.
